avo pits are pretty unpalatable. lots of antioxidants though. i haven't got any avocados yet. just sprouted plants. it takes 3 years till they flower so i have some time to wait but i'm hopeful. i read that there is a good chance to get fruit from them even though they usually require the opposite type flower to pollinate. either a person is in the climate where avocados are already growing so the pollen will be available or the mild weather makes the flowers pollen receptivity overlap the release.
